Beschreibung:

Set of Eight Brown-Westhead, Moore & Co. Gilt and Transfer Decorated 'Cauldon Ware' Porcelain Dessert Plates Pattern no. B7317 Diameter 8 3/4 inches. Provenance: With Elise Abrams Antiques, Great Barrington, MA, October 1998 Hester Diamond Estate, New York. C
each appears to be in generally good undamaged condition; typical wear and rubbing to gilding, most notably to the rim edges; typical scratch marks to the centers, commensurate with age and usage; one plate has a small area where there is some rubbing (loss) to the pale yellow ground revealing a small white patch and adjacent area of wear (white porcelain body); puce printed crowned Royal Warrant marks; not blacklighted; age: circa 1890-1900
